Work #LikeABosch\n* Reinvent yourself: At Bosch, you will evolve.\n* Discover new directions: At Bosch, you will find your place.\n* Balance your life: At Bosch, your job matches your lifestyle.\n* Celebrate success: At Bosch, we celebrate you.\n* Be yourself: At Bosch, we value values.\n* Shape tomorrow: At Bosch, you change lives.\n\nJob Description\n\nThe Advanced Material Handler (Source 1) is responsible for operating order pickers and standard forklifts to support shipping, receiving, and production activities. This position involves accurately picking, moving, and organizing materials, including heavy and oversized items, while working at elevated heights within a warehouse or dock environment. This role requires maintaining efficiency, accuracy, and adherence to company procedures in a fast-paced setting.\n\nKey Responsibilities\n\nOperate order pickers, standard forklifts, and pallet jacks to accurately pick, transport, and stage materials\nEfficiently load, unload, and sort palletized and non-palletized freight\nUse handheld scanning devices to track inventory and shipments\nSecure freight inside trailers using proper tools and techniques\nHandle heavy materials, including coils, equipment, and large components\nWork in a safe and efficient manner while adhering to company policies\nMaintain productivity and accuracy while working at heights\nQualifications\nHigh school diploma or GED required\n1+ years of experience operating forklifts or material handling equipment in a manufacturing, warehouse, or distribution environment preferred\nExperience in shipping, receiving, and/or production material movement preferred\nExperience handling heavy materials (e.g., coils, dies, large equipment) strongly preferred\nBasic computer skills, including experience with handheld scanners or inventory systems\nAbility to read and understand work instructions, safety rules, and shipping documents\nComfortable working at heights while using fall protection equipment\nMust be able to work in a non-climate-controlled environment and adapt to varying temperatures\nAbility to lift and move heavy materials and perform physical tasks as required\nStrong commitment to safety and adherence to company safety policies\nAdditional Information\n\nIndefinite U.S. work authorized individuals only.
